#1f7da0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f7da0 is composed of 12.2% red, 49%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 21.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 196.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 37.5%. #1f7da0 color hex could be obtained by blending #3efaff with #000041.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#1f7da0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f7da0 has RGB values of R:31, G:125,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 2063776.

Shades and Tints of #1f7da0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090c is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f7da0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a6265 is the less saturated color, while #028abd is the most saturated one.
